A complete reference for all expression syntax supported by LineSolv.
Standard PEMDAS (Parentheses, Exponents, Multiplication/Division, Addition/Subtraction) with six operators:
| Operator | Meaning | Example | Result |
|---|
+ | Addition | 5 + 3 | 8 |
- | Subtraction | 10 - 4 | 6 |
* | Multiplication | 7 * 3 | 21 |
/ | Division | 20 / 4 | 5 |
^ | Exponentiation | 2 ^ 10 | 1024 |
% | Modulo (remainder) | 17 % 5 | 2 |
× | Multiplication (symbol) | 5×3 | 15 |
÷ | Division (symbol) | 10 ÷ 2 | 5 |
Operator precedence: ^ > * / % > + -. Use parentheses to override.
| Input | Result | Note |
|---|
2 + 3 * 4 | 14 | Multiplication first |
(2 + 3) * 4 | 20 | Parentheses override |
2^3^2 | 512 | Right-associative: 2^(32) |

Assign variables and reference them in later expressions:
| Input | Result |
|---|
x = 42 | x = 42 |
x * 2 | 84 |
y = x + 8 | y = 50 |
y / 2 | 25 |
x * pi | 131.947 |
Variable names are case-insensitive. You can use any alphanumeric name (no spaces, must start with a letter).

All 40+ built-in functions:
| Category | Function | Args | Description | Example | Result |
|---|
| Trigonometry | sin(x) | 1 | Sine (radians) | sin(pi/4) | 0.7071 |
| cos(x) | 1 | Cosine (radians) | cos(0) | 1 |
| tan(x) | 1 | Tangent (radians) | tan(0) | 0 |
| asin(x) | 1 | Arcsine (radians) | asin(1) | 1.5708 |
| acos(x) | 1 | Arccosine (radians) | acos(1) | 0 |
| atan(x) | 1 | Arctangent (radians) | atan(0) | 0 |
| atan2(y, x) | 2 | 2-argument arctangent | atan2(1, 1) | 0.7854 |
| Hyperbolic | sinh(x) | 1 | Hyperbolic sine | sinh(0) | 0 |
| cosh(x) | 1 | Hyperbolic cosine | cosh(0) | 1 |
| tanh(x) | 1 | Hyperbolic tangent | tanh(0) | 0 |
| Logarithmic | log(x) / ln(x) | 1 | Natural logarithm | ln(100) | 4.6052 |
| log2(x) | 1 | Base-2 logarithm | log2(8) | 3 |
| log10(x) | 1 | Base-10 logarithm | log10(100) | 2 |
| exp(x) | 1 | e^x | exp(1) | 2.7183 |
| Roots & Power | sqrt(x) | 1 | Square root | sqrt(144) | 12 |
| cbrt(x) | 1 | Cube root | cbrt(27) | 3 |
| pow(a, b) | 2 | a raised to b | pow(2, 3) | 8 |
| Rounding | round(x) | 1 | Round to nearest integer | round(3.7) | 4 |
| ceil(x) | 1 | Round up | ceil(3.2) | 4 |
| floor(x) | 1 | Round down | floor(3.7) | 3 |
| trunc(x) | 1 | Truncate decimal | trunc(3.7) | 3 |
| sign(x) / sgn(x) | 1 | Sign: -1, 0, or 1 | sign(-3) | -1 |
| Absolute | abs(x) | 1 | Absolute value | abs(-5) | 5 |
| Statistics | avg(n, ...) | 1+ | Arithmetic mean | avg(1, 2, 3) | 2 |
| median(n, ...) | 1+ | Median value | median(1, 2, 3) | 2 |
| mode(n, ...) | 1+ | Most frequent value | mode(1, 1, 2) | 1 |
| stdev(n, ...) / stddev(n, ...) | 2+ | Population standard deviation | stdev(10, 20, 30) | 8.1650 |
| variance(n, ...) / var(n, ...) | 2+ | Population variance | variance(10, 20, 30) | 66.6667 |
| range(n, ...) | 1+ | max minus min | range(1, 5, 3) | 4 |
| Aggregation | sum(n, ...) | 1+ | Sum of all arguments | sum(1, 2, 3) | 6 |
| min(n, ...) | 1+ | Smallest value | min(1, 2, 3) | 1 |
| max(n, ...) | 1+ | Largest value | max(1, 2, 3) | 3 |
| Combinatorics | fact(x) / factorial(x) | 1 | Factorial (max 20) | fact(5) | 120 |
| gcd(a, b) | 2 | Greatest common divisor | gcd(12, 8) | 4 |
| lcm(a, b) | 2 | Least common multiple | lcm(4, 6) | 12 |
| ncr(n, r) / choose(n, r) | 2 | Combinations (n choose r) | ncr(5, 3) | 10 |
| Random | rand() | 0-2 | Random number (0-1, 0-max, or min-max) | rand() | 0.7234 |
| random(x) | 0-2 | Alias for rand | random(10) | 7.2341 |
| Geometry | hypot(a, b) / pythag(a, b) / hypotenuse(a, b) | 2 | sqrt(a^2 + b^2) | hypot(3, 4) | 5 |
| Utility | fract(x) | 1 | Fractional part | fract(3.7) | 0.7 |
| deg(x) | 1 | Radians to degrees | deg(pi) | 180 |
| rad(x) | 1 | Degrees to radians | rad(180) | 3.1416 |
| Number Theory | isprime(x) / is_prime(x) | 1 | 1 if prime, 0 otherwise | isprime(7) | 1 |
